At PokerStars, we deal many varieties of poker, some of which use different hand rankings. Hold’em, Omaha, Seven Card Stud and Five Card Draw all use the traditional ‘high’ poker rankings. Omaha Hi/Lo, Razz and Stud Hi/Lo use the ‘Ace to Five’ (‘California’) low hand rankings for low hands. Texas Holdem Rules | How to Play Texas Hold'em Poker ...

Poker Hand Ranking & Texas Hold'Em.Four cards of the same rank - such as four queens. The fifth card can be anything. This combination is sometimes known as "quads", and in some parts of Europe it is called a " poker", though this term for it is unknown in English. These poker hands can make Broadway – the best straight in Hold'em, A-K-Q-J-10. If this straight is all in the same suit, you'll have the Royal, the best-ranked hand in Hold'em. Connectors. Many players in Texas Hold’em like to play connecting cards like J-10, 9-8 and 6-5, for example, because of their straight making potential.
